Output b078d24bc42362661df710fc496fcda2e619f1eea2ca00a02a5cea0e3a938e42:1

value
780909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15f2bca6ba8c0a9d952e795612a44d26b3d68124 OP_EQUAL
address
33h4uEEdH9ouaS9BWx1VZczhRhqFrfFhzE
transaction
b078d24bc42362661df710fc496fcda2e619f1eea2ca00a02a5cea0e3a938e42
confirmations
303228
spent
true